Latest Patents
Among his latest work, Lau developed innovative methods and apparatus for optimizing high-level language code sequences for programmable chip implementations. His patents center around converting critical loops in high-level language software into read/transform/write (RXW) processes, incorporating buffer-based flow control. This novel approach ensures that separate read and write processes allows for an arbitrary number of sequential reads and writes to occur in any order, subject to buffer size. This results in more efficient bursting and sequential transactions compared to random accesses, making chip designs more versatile and effective.
